Rebeca Blanchard holds a degree in Art History from University College London. She worked in the curatorial departments of the MoMA and the Guggenheim in New York between 2002 and 2003, before founding NoguerasBlanchard in Barcelona with her partner Àlex Nogueras in 2004. Since then, the gallery has developed an international and interdisciplinary program, reflecting a variety of conceptually driven positions and practices. In 2024, it partnered with the Joan Prats gallery to form Prats Nogueras Blanchard, with locations in Madrid and Barcelona. Combining the trajectory of both galleries, the program seeks to foster dialogue between established and emerging artists, presenting works from different periods and contexts, with a special focus on the Mediterranean and Latin America. The gallery participates in leading international fairs, including Art Basel Paris, ARCOmadrid, and Art Basel Basel. Rebeca served on the ARCO selection committee from 2010 to 2014 and, since 2012, has lived between Madrid and Barcelona to direct the gallery’s Madrid location.
